The Syntax-Morphology Interface of Verb-Complement Compounds in Mandarin Chinese

Abstract

dc:description

This thesis pursues a modular analysis of verb-complement compounds in Mandarin Chinese. As the evidence indicates, a syntactic or lexical analysis is proposed for different types of compounds. As a result, this analysis can better account for the individual properties of each type of compound. This approach differs from previous analyses in that all of the previous analyses propose a uniform derivation, syntactic or lexical, for every type of compound.
